Fig. 6: The calendar aging of LPS based AFBs.

From: Understanding the failure process of sulfide-based all-solid-state lithium batteries via operando nuclear magnetic resonance spectroscopy

Fig. 6: The calendar aging of LPS based AFBs.The alternative text for this image may have been generated using AI.

a Charge/discharge curves of the first cycle, with/without 12 h of OCV hold after charging to 4.2 V. b Charge/discharge curves of the 8th cycle, with/without 12 h of OCV hold after charging to 4.2 V (inset: evolution of the Coulombic efficiency during cycling). The error bar represents the standard error for three independent experiments. c, d The integral area of the lithium metal signal versus time and the corresponding charge/discharge curve, with 12 h OCV hold in the first cycle (c) and in the 5th and 6th cycles (d) after charging to 4.2 V. The error bar represents 30× standard deviation of spectral noise. e, f Schematic representation of the different corrosion rates of flat lithium (e) and dendritic lithium (f).
